WebMar 25, 2024 · The acronym SS in football refers to the position of strong safety. The strong safety is one of two starting safety positions and primarily lines up on the strong side of the formation. The strong side of the formation refers to the side of the formation which has more players. Generally speaking, this is going to be the side that features the ... WebA strong safety will start the play on the strong side of the field -- which is determined by how the offense lines up. In most cases, the tight end will signify where the strong side of the field is.
